Leslie begins the show with her 'Ripped from the Headlines' news segment.
Here are the stories she covers during the segment:
1. AUDIO: Dr. Anthony Fauci, the top infectious disease expert at the National Institutes of Health, warned that the U.S. could see 100,000 new coronavirus cases per day, while he was speaking at a Senate hearing today on COVID-19
2. CNN: "From pandering to Putin to abusing allies and ignoring his own advisers, Trump's phone calls alarm US officials" by Carl Bernstein (Investigative Journalist who helped break the Watergate scandal)
3. AXIOS: "European Union extends ban on U.S. travelers as borders reopen"
4. AXIOS: "Amy McGrath wins Kentucky Democratic Senate primary"
Leslie is then joined by Colonel Cedric Leighton, Founder and President of Cedric Leighton Associates, a strategic risk and leadership consultancy serving global companies and organizations. He founded the company in 2010, after serving in the US Air Force for 26 years as an Intelligence Officer and attaining the rank of Colonel.
They talk about the reported bounties that Russia offered to pay out to the Taliban in Afghanistan for the killing of American soldiers. Additionally, they discuss new reporting from the Associated Press that President Trump and top White House officials had been briefed on the bounties multiple times dating all the way back to March of 2019.
Leslie and Colonel Leighton also speculate as to why there has been no response by the Trump administration against Russia for the bounties, and what kind of message that sends to U.S. military members and their families.
